Output 861e436c4161d6cf89144602a4dc6dc96eadc198a7fc81191c56b9eb35e0a5a8:1

value
85104698
script pubkey
OP_0 OP_PUSHBYTES_20 bef43bd02b0049f49a76c95d1be458ad25ff4216
address
bc1qhm6rh5ptqpylfxnke9w3hezc45jl7ssktxcxd8
transaction
861e436c4161d6cf89144602a4dc6dc96eadc198a7fc81191c56b9eb35e0a5a8
confirmations
278246
spent
true